Given that:
Mauna Loa :
4,170 meters (from sea level to summit)
-5000 meters (base of mountain to sea level)
Depth of probe dropped from summit of Mauna Loa = 7500 m
Height of probe relative to sea level :
Depth of probe - height of Mauna Loa(from sea level to summit)
7500 m - 4170 m = 3330 m
Hence, height of probe relative to sea level :
4170m above sea level
3330m below sea level
Distance of probe from base of volcano:
Total depth of Mauna Loa = (4170 + 5000) = 9170m
Total depth of probe = 7500 m
Distance of probe from base :
9170 - 7500 = 1670 m
The probe is 1670 m from the base of the volcano.
